Sesame seeds (Japan), starch, sugar, salt; KUROMITSU: Sugar mixed with glucose fructose syrup, sugar, muscovado black sugar syrup (muscovado black sugar, brown sugar, starch syrup), salt / Caramel color e150 (may contain traces of sulfites), sweetener (e955); KINAKO: Soybeans, sugar, salt
Allergens: Sesame, soy, sulfites
Store away from light, heat and moisture.
Per 100g : Energy: 89kcal Protein: 2g Fat: 2.2g Carbohydrates: 15.4g Salt: 0.3g
Turn out your tofu into a container, pour in the kuromitsu, then the kinako included in the bag.
Houmoto was founded in 1952 in Sasebo by the ancestors of the current managing director. This family-run company has been making sesame tofu for three generations. This specialty arrived in Nagasaki in the 17th century thanks to Buddhist monks. Since then, the company has developed a unique technique for roasting sesame seeds to meet the high expectations of Nagasaki's inhabitants and ensure consistent quality. In addition, products are made to order and contain only the finest natural ingredients to guarantee optimum freshness.
